The cost of a full head hair transplant in Vancouver can vary significantly depending on several factors, including the clinic's reputation, the surgeon's expertise, and the specific techniques used. Generally, the price range for a full head hair transplant can start from around CAD 5,000 and go up to CAD 20,000 or more.
Factors influencing the cost include: 1. Surgeon's Experience: Highly experienced surgeons often charge more due to their proven track record and skill. 2. Technique Used: Methods like Follicular Unit Extraction (FUE) and Follicular Unit Transplantation (FUT) have different costs. FUE, which is less invasive, tends to be more expensive. 3. Number of Grafts: The total number of hair grafts required for a full head transplant can significantly impact the cost. 4. Clinic's Location and Reputation: Premium locations and well-established clinics may charge higher fees.
It's essential to consult with a reputable clinic in Vancouver to get a personalized quote based on your specific needs and hair condition. Always consider the quality of service and the surgeon's expertise over just the cost to ensure the best possible outcome.

Factors Influencing the Cost
The cost of a full head hair transplant is influenced by various elements, including the extent of hair loss, the number of grafts required, the technique used, and the expertise of the surgeon. In Vancouver, these factors can lead to a wide range of prices, typically between $5,000 and $20,000.
Extent of Hair Loss
The severity of hair loss plays a crucial role in determining the cost. Patients with extensive hair loss will require more grafts, which can increase the overall expense. On the other hand, those with minimal hair loss may need fewer grafts, resulting in a lower cost.
Number of Grafts Required
The number of grafts needed is directly proportional to the cost. Each graft contains one to four hair follicles. Generally, a full head hair transplant can require anywhere from 1,500 to 4,000 grafts. The more grafts needed, the higher the cost.
Techniques Used
Two primary techniques are commonly used in hair transplants: Follicular Unit Transplantation (FUT) and Follicular Unit Extraction (FUE). FUT involves removing a strip of skin from the donor area, while FUE involves extracting individual follicles. FUE is often more expensive due to its precision and less invasive nature.
Expertise of the Surgeon
The experience and reputation of the surgeon can significantly impact the cost. Highly skilled and experienced surgeons often charge more for their services. However, investing in a skilled surgeon can ensure better results and a higher success rate.
Additional Costs
It's also important to consider additional costs such as pre-operative consultations, post-operative care, medications, and follow-up appointments. These costs can add up, so it's wise to inquire about them during your initial consultation.

Average Cost Range
In Vancouver, the cost of a full head hair transplant can range from $5,000 to $20,000 or more. This wide range is due to the aforementioned factors. For instance, a patient with moderate hair loss might expect to pay around $8,000 for an FUE procedure, while someone with extensive hair loss could pay closer to $15,000.
Additional Costs to Consider
Beyond the initial procedure, there may be additional costs to consider:
Pre-Operative Consultations: These are essential for assessing your suitability for the procedure and can sometimes incur a fee.
Post-Operative Care: Proper aftercare is crucial for the success of the transplant. This may include medications, follow-up appointments, and any necessary touch-up procedures.
Travel and Accommodation: If you are traveling to Vancouver for the procedure, you will need to factor in travel and accommodation costs.
